Re: error running JSP Config on tomcat examples - tomcat 5.0.19

2004-03-23 Thread Erin O'Neill
I found out what my configuration error was! I'm sending it to this list so 
if another newbie has problems they might google out this answer! :)

(I really hate it when someone just replies to the list -- oh never mind I 
got it! and then doesn't give the answer!)

I found this link:
http://johnturner.com/howto/apache2-tomcat4127-jk-rh9-howto.html
AND even though it was for Tomcat 4 and linux I figured it might have *the* 
answer for me. It did.

I needed to run tomcat as the tomcat user (this involved changing the 
ownership of the tomcat directory  files as I'd already set it up as 
root). While the ENV variables were being set in the /etc/init.d/tomcat 
script and EXPORTED -- they weren't making it to catalina.sh. I explicitly 
set JAVA_HOME, CLASSPATH, PATH in setclasspath.sh.

CLASSPATH is set thusly in setclasspath.sh:
CLASSPATH=$JAVA_HOME/lib/tools.jar
It seems to add to the already setup CLASSPATH in the startup script.  PATH 
needed to include $JAVA_HOME/bin, $CATALINA_HOME/bin and $JRE_HOME/bin. 
Suddenly the java compiler was found!

error running JSP Config on tomcat examples - tomcat 5.0.19

2004-03-18 Thread Erin O'Neill
Hello all -
I'm new to setting up a tomcat server. I was asked to install tomcat 5. I 
can get a stand alone tomcat server up and running but some of the examples 
fail. Particulars of my system:

Tomcat/5.0.18  (I've got t.0.19 running??)
Apache/2.0.48
JVM  version:  1.4.2_03-b02
Solaris 2.8
I use a shell script to start up tomcat. The env vars are:
CATALINA_HOME=/usr/local/tomcat;export CATALINA_HOME
JAVA_HOME=/usr/j2se;export JAVA_HOME
(I also tried setting JAVA_HOME to point to the symlink /usr/java which 
points to /usr/j2se but it gave me the same error).

(on tomcat-users it was recommended to add the CLASSPATH)
CLASSPATH=\
$JAVA_HOME/lib/tools.jar:\
$DAEMON_HOME/commons-daemon.jar:\
$CATALINA_HOME/bin/bootstrap.jar
export CLASSPATH
I added a PATH
PATH=\
/usr/java/bin:/usr/local/bin:\
/usr/sbin:/usr/bin:/usr/local/tomcat/bin:\
/usr/local/mysql/bin:/usr/ccs/bin:
export PATH
The error message is:

description The server encountered an internal error () that prevented it 
from fulfilling this request.

exception
org.apache.jasper.JasperException: Unable to compile class for JSP
No Java compiler was found to compile the generated source for the JSP.
This can usually be solved by copying manually $JAVA_HOME/lib/tools.jar 
from the JDK
to the common/lib directory of the Tomcat server, followed by a Tomcat 
restart.
If using an alternate Java compiler, please check its installation and 
access path.



org.apache.jasper.compiler.DefaultErrorHandler.javacError(DefaultErrorHandler.java:127)
org.apache.jasper.compiler.ErrorDispatcher.javacError(ErrorDispatcher.java:351)
org.apache.jasper.compiler.Compiler.generateClass(Compiler.java:415)
org.apache.jasper.compiler.Compiler.compile(Compiler.java:458)
org.apache.jasper.compiler.Compiler.compile(Compiler.java:439)
org.apache.jasper.JspCompilationContext.compile(JspCompilationContext.java:552)
org.apache.jasper.servlet.JspServletWrapper.service(JspServletWrapper.java:291)
org.apache.jasper.servlet.JspServlet.serviceJspFile(JspServlet.java:301)
org.apache.jasper.servlet.JspServlet.service(JspServlet.java:248)
javax.servlet.http.HttpServlet.service(HttpServlet.java:856)
In the catalina.out log I see this error:
Mar 18, 2004 9:58:46 AM org.apache.jasper.compiler.Compiler generateClass
SEVERE: Javac exception
Unable to find a javac compiler;
com.sun.tools.javac.Main is not on the classpath.
Perhaps JAVA_HOME does not point to the JDK
BUT the javac compiler is in the CLASSPATH AND the PATH?? Do I need to set 
this up elsewhere? JAVA_HOME is also set up??
